A man is in hospital with life-threatening injuries after a disturbance in Glasgow city centre.

Police were called to Argyle Street near the Argyll Arcade at around 1am on Saturday.

Officers attended and found an injured 32-year-old man who was taken to Glasgow Royal Infirmary.

Medical staff describe his condition as life-threatening.

A 19-year-old man has been arrested and detained and is expected to appear at Glasgow Sheriff Court on Monday.
